1、将截断字符串或二进制数据。语句已终止! 这是声明原因呢? 代码为下
2025-03-10 23:12:00
导读 2、🔍遇到一个数据库操作时出现的问题,提示“将截断字符串或二进制数据。语句已终止!”,这到底是什么原因呢?🤔当我们在处理数据库中的数...
2、
🔍遇到一个数据库操作时出现的问题,提示“将截断字符串或二进制数据。语句已终止!”,这到底是什么原因呢?🤔
当我们在处理数据库中的数据时,有时会因为输入的数据长度超过了字段允许的最大长度,导致系统抛出这样的错误。这种情况通常发生在字符串或二进制数据上。💼
例如,如果你有一个VARCHAR类型的字段,最大长度为50个字符,但你尝试插入一个超过50个字符的字符串,就会触发这个警告。⚠️
为了解决这个问题,我们需要检查数据长度,并确保其不超过字段定义的最大长度。或者,如果确实需要存储更长的数据,可以考虑修改表结构,增加字段长度。🛠️
以下是可能产生上述错误的示例代码片段:
```sql
INSERT INTO example_table (data_column) VALUES ('This is a very long string that will cause truncation');
```
希望这些信息能帮助你解决遇到的问题!🚀
数据库 SQL 编程
免责声明:本文由用户上传,如有侵权请联系删除!
猜你喜欢
- 03-10
- 03-10
- 03-10
- 03-10
- 03-10
- 03-10
- 03-10
- 03-10
最新文章
- 03-10
- 03-10
- 03-10
- 03-10
- 03-10
- 03-10
- 03-10
- 03-10